I have used an old version of CATraxx for years but have retired the system it ran on. I upgraded the CATraxx database from an unremembered version of Access through Access 2007 and into Access 2010 using the Access built-in upgrade process, and I have the Access db files for both versions. The database opens OK in Access and I can query tables.
Access files:
OURCDS.MDB (unknown Access version) OurCDs2007.accdb (upgraded to Access 2007) OurCDs2010.accdb (upgraded to Access 2010)
The current verison of CATraxx gets an error trying to open the databases
i have the following saved install vesions of CATraxx:
7 10/21/2015 8-20 8 9-31 9-32 9-33 9-34 9-35 9-41 9-44_Final 9-47_Final 9-48 9-52 9-55
Can someone advise on how I can get my CATraxx database back in sync to the CATraxx vesions? I assume that along the way the CATRaxx installs must have made database design modifications that are missing in my database version. I insrtalled v9.55 and it errors out trying to open my database.
Is there anything short of installing each old vesion in succession and try to open my database?

This is a tough one. CATraxx will only open MDB files. Ver 9 should open it and prompt to upgrade if needed. How ever if you have made changes to the database structure, more than likely it will fail. If you can get the files back to Access 2002-2003 that may help too.
